#e7dc94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7dc94 is composed of 90.6% red, 86.3%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.8% magenta, 35.9%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 52 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 74.3%. #e7dc94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cfb929.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#e7dc94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7dc94 has RGB values of R:231, G:220,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.36,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15195284.

Shades and Tints of #e7dc94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050501 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7dc94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fbebc is the less saturated color, while #fbeb80 is the most saturated one.
